The siding is backed with very good warranties discussed below. Steel log siding is installed using the same techniques and accessories as standard steel or vinyl siding, so the process goes quickly. Foam backer inserts are added for stability and an R-value of 3 to 4. Some designs include faux chinking.ĭurable coatings are designed to resist fading, cracking, and blistering. The material is stamped with authentic wood texture: cedar, pine, weathered wood and more. Lightweight G-90 galvanized steel 26 gauge (thicker) and 28-gauge steel is used. EverLog Siding™ĮverLog Siding is an engineered concrete log siding and concrete timber siding product used on renovations and new construction projects. Log profiles available range from 16” hand-hewn timbers to 12” milled round logs with a variety of saddle notch and dovetail corners. Typically used as an exterior wall system, EverLogs provide superior maintenance free performance and appearance over traditional wood log homes. What products does EverLog Systems offer?ĮverLog Systems offers three concrete log and timber products, these include: EverLogs™ĮverLogs are insulated, structural, handcrafted concrete logs used on everything from log houses and log cabins to luxury log homes.
